Bogoro LG Chairman, Sumi Warns BAROTA Officers On Corruption, Indiscipline

By: Ajiya Ayuba,
The chairman of Bogoro Local Government area, Yakubu Lawi Sumi
on Monday warned the personnel of the Bauchi Road Transport Agency (BAROTA) against corruption, indiscipline and abuse of power.
The chairman made this known while addressing the personnel in his Bogoro Secretariat office.
He said that such behaviors would not and never be tolerated by the administration of the State Governor, Bala Mohammed Abdulkadir and also his own leadership.
Sumi said the deployment of the personnel will definitely reduce traffic and accidents.
He assured them of his administration’s commitment to collaborate closely for the effective delivery of traffic management and road safety services.
The council boss emphasized the importance of discipline, professionalism, and dedication to duty, urging the newly deployed traffic marshals to uphold the values in the execution of their responsibilities.
According to him said “BAROTA plays a critical role in addressing road transport challenges, enforcing traffic laws, ensuring public safety, and managing traffic flow not only within Bogoro but across Bauchi State,” the Chairman said.
“My administration is fully committed to supporting the agency with resources, infrastructure, and continuous training to maintain the highest standards of integrity, professionalism, and compassion.”
He urged the newly deploys officers to the local government that they should uphold self respect, obey the laws of the land, and maintain dignity in the services they render.
The local government Chairman assured them his support and collaboration, particularly considering Bogoro’s strategic position bordering other local government areas.
Responding, the team commander of the BAROTA, ASP Yakubu Bulus, expressed his appreciation to the local government Chairman for his unwavering support and leadership.
The team commander promised that his people will work diligently to the development of Bogoro,Bauchi and Nigeria at large.
